Be Aware When Driving a Forklift Truck
Forklifts are large industrial equipment making safety a key matter when utilizing these trucks. The forklift operators are required by law to be trained and qualified prior to driving these equipment. Anyone who misuses a lift truck truck could be charged with an offence. Misuse of this potentially dangerous machine could cause serious injury or fatality. Safe use of a forklift truck includes paying complete attention both to what is happening around the vehicle and to what is happening in the vehicle. Not different to driving a car, driving a forklift requires keeping your attention on the road and being aware of other vehicles and pedestrians.

Essential forklift driving tips
Accidents at the worksite are far too frequent. Nonetheless, numerous accidents are avoidable by lessening the risks while working with machinery which are heavy and dangerous.

Uneven surfaces and drops are frequently encountered while operating a forklift since the majority of operating surfaces are relatively rough and uneven. The largest dangers are dock bridges, dock platforms, bumps, pot holes, inclines and ramps. Forklifts are engineered to deal with uneven surfaces, but it is the operators responsibility to keep control of the truck and to be on the lookout for these hazards.

Visibility is amongst the crucial factors in lift truck mishaps. The operator is responsible for ensuring clear visibility when using a lift truck by checking that mirrors are positioned correctly and that all windows are unobstructed and clean. If a load is placed in such a way that it obscures visibility for the forklift operator, then the operator has to put the lift truck in reverse and cautiously back down the ramp.

Operators of forklifts are lawfully required to carry out daily inspections of the lift truck truck and its parts. A more methodical examination must be performed weekly. The forks, tires, engine, brakes and so forth must always be checked so as to ensure that they are properly working. Proper inspections could help to avoid mishaps and injury.
